Best Beaches in Miami: A Complete Guide to Sun, Sand, and Surf

Best Miami Beaches

Miami Beach is a world-renowned coastal beach located in Miami-Dade County Florida USA. Miami is famous for its stunning beaches, vibrant nightlife, and luxurious resorts. The Miami Beach Architectural District, also known as the Art Deco District, is a popular tourist destination that showcases over 800 historic buildings. 

In addition to its beautiful beaches and architecture, Miami Beach is a hub of cultural and recreational activities. 

Best beaches in Miami

Many beautiful beaches are available to choose from in Miami, which is known for them. Here are some of the most popular beaches in Miami:

  • South Beach
  • Haulover beach Miami
  • Cocoa Beach to Miami
  • Daytona Beach
  • Key Biscayne Beach Miami

These are just a few of the many beautiful beaches that Miami has to offer.

South Beach

Best Miami Beaches

The longest and most renowned among Miami’s beaches is South Beach, featuring a sweeping expanse of white sand and shimmering turquoise waters. It’s also known for its colorful lifeguard towers and vibrant nightlife.

South Beach is a neighborhood in Miami Florida known for its beautiful beaches, vibrant nightlife, and Art Deco architecture. It is located at the southernmost tip of Miami Beach, between Biscayne Bay and the Atlantic Ocean.

South Beach is a popular tourist destination and offers a wide range of activities for visitors. The soft white sand and clear water of its beaches make it an ideal spot for swimming, sunbathing, and water sports.

South Beach also offers world-class dining, shopping, and nightlife. The south beach area is also well known because of its trendy and wide range of restaurants, boutique shops, and art galleries, as well as a bustling nightlife scene that includes some of the most famous nightclubs in the world.

South Beach is also known for its iconic Art Deco architecture. Visitors can take a walking tour to explore the many Art Deco buildings in the area and learn about their history and significance.

Haulover beach Miami

Best Miami Beaches

Haulover Beach is a public beach located in Miami Florida USA. It is known for its beautiful white sand, crystal clear water, and stunning views of the Atlantic Ocean.

Haulover Beach is also famous for being one of the few clothing-optional beaches in the country and attracts a diverse crowd of visitors. The clothing-optional section is clearly marked and separated from the rest of the beach, so visitors can choose whether or not to go nude.

For swimming and sunbathing, Haulover Beach offers a variety of activities, including fishing, surfing, kiteboarding, and volleyball. There are also picnic areas, showers, and restrooms available for visitors.

Haulover Beach is a popular destination for both locals and tourists alike. Offering a unique and memorable beach experience in the heart of Miami.

Cocoa Beach 

Known for its great surfing conditions, Cocoa Beach has waves suitable for both beginners and advanced surfers. There are several surf schools in the area that offer lessons and equipment rental.

There are many cruise lines that depart from Port Canaveral, just a few miles from the south of Cocoa Beach. You can choose from short weekend cruises to the Bahamas or longer Caribbean cruises.

Daytona Beach

Best Miami Beaches

Visitors to Daytona Beach can enjoy a variety of outdoor activities, including fishing, golfing, surfing, and beach volleyball.

The area also earns its reputation for wide, sandy beaches, boardwalk, and exciting auto racing events It also has several museums, including the Daytona Beach Museum of Arts and Sciences, and the Halifax Historical Museum.

Daytona Beach has a warm and humid subtropical climate, with hot summers and mild winters. The best time to visit Daytona Beach is between March and May when the weather is pleasant, and there are fewer crowds.

Key Biscayne Beach Miami

Key Biscayne Beach is a beautiful beach located in Miami Florida. The beach is situated on the barrier island of Key Biscayne, which is south of Miami Beach and east of Miami.

People know Key Biscayne Beach for its crystal-clear water, soft sand, and picturesque views. Visitors can enjoy various water activities, including swimming, snorkeling, paddle boarding, kayaking, and fishing. The beach is also a popular spot for sunbathing and relaxing under the sun.

Key Biscayne also offers a wide range of facilities and attractions, including a golf course, a tennis center, a historic lighthouse, and several parks. Visitors can also take a short boat ride to explore the nearby natural wonder, the Stiltsville Houses.

Key Biscayne Beach is a must-visit destination for anyone traveling to Miami who wants to experience the best of what the area has to offer.


Overall, Miami has a bustling and diverse beach that offers a unique blend of tropical weather, vibrant culture, and world-class attractions. Visitors to Miami can enjoy its beautiful beaches, lively nightlife, and rich cultural scene, which includes museums, art galleries, and performing arts venues. With its sunny climate, diverse population, and endless opportunities for entertainment, Beaches in Miami have great things for everyone to enjoy.

Previous Discover the Wonders of the Jacksonville Zoo and Gardens
Next Life in Miami: Unveiling the Allure of the Sunshine City

No Comment

Leave a reply

Your email address will not be published. Required fields are marked *